Output e149faa188d65dbf841cee2d0e479325d6f07eba5a95138cc311345fa0c2518a:98

value
185082
script pubkey
OP_0 OP_PUSHBYTES_32 fa2555524e8eb31bf7d128923ea69c169c9928629c586497e1959e3e5c01376c
address
bc1qlgj425jw36e3ha739zfraf5uz6wfj2rzn3vxf9lpjk0ruhqpxakq6jmye8
transaction
e149faa188d65dbf841cee2d0e479325d6f07eba5a95138cc311345fa0c2518a
confirmations
153043
spent
true